Upload or replace a common sound file

Common sound files must be uploaded so they are available for playing when a call is transferred to a survey. If you need to change an uploaded sound file, you can replace it by uploading the new file. These sound files are used for agent prompts and customer messages.

The number of common sound files that you need to create and upload depends on your call transfer definitions.

  • Agent prompts: These sound files prompt the agent to manually enter an ID or code when a call transfer input setting has been configured for manual entry (Agent ID, Language, Transaction, or a customer-specific input such as Case Number). Depending on which information is manually entered, it can associates an agent with the survey and provide information that determines which survey is played for the customer.

  • Customer messages: These sound files provide a message when there is a problem that prevents the designated survey from playing or successful transfer of the call to the survey server. These sound files are not related to a call transfer input setting, and should be uploaded for any Common Sound File language in a call transfer setting.

Procedure 

  1. Click System Management > Customer Feedback > Common Sound Files.

  2. Under the appropriate language, locate the sound component.

  3. Click the File uploadicon.

  4. Choose a file, and click OK.

    The sound file name is displayed on the page.

  5. Do one of the following:

    • To review a sound file prior to uploading it, click the Speakericon next to file name.

    • To upload the sound file(s), click Save.

      If sound file(s), do not meet the specifications, the name of the file is displayed in red. You can replace these files with files in the correct format.
